Analytic solutions to superconductor-insulator-superconductor quantum mixer theory

Three-port quantum mixer theory for superconductor-insulator-superconductor tunnel junctions is solved for several simple cases of practical interest. Closed form solutions are derived for the conversion gain in the low local oscillator power limit, and also the general conditions for zero and infinite gain. These results are useful in understanding more general computer calculations of predicted performance. Practical limits to gain and dynamic range are analyzed both for series arrays and single junctions.
